_[Filler note — replace with a real one.]_ I used to pride myself on reading
three papers a day. Then I noticed I couldn't reconstruct the argument of any
of them a week later.

Now I read one paper slowly, with a pen. The constraint is the feature: if a
claim doesn't survive being rewritten in my own words, I didn't understand
it, and neither — sometimes — did the authors.
